Social Democrat Initiative Chairman Fatmir Limaj criticised the Kurti Government for not realising any serious capital investment.
According to Limaj, under Kurti's leadership the country is being managed, it is not being governed.
The Kosovo government is measured by budget, what is the budget? Take away the salaries and the social aid, you see that zero budget has been spent, 70 percent of the budget they speak about has been spent on wages, no investment has taken place, capital investments, find me a serious capital investment that has taken place in the last three years, find me a project, a job, a concrete commitment in these last three years, Kosovo government has been reduced to management, we are not being run, it has shown that no plan, no project, they are uncognised people, they have got the courage in decision<1 years, said Limajkoj in Kosovo's Rubikon.
The first Social Democrat Initiative said in Rubik, that Kurti Government is following the examples of authoritarian countries in the region by apprehending and controlling all public institutions.
